About this match
Neither player arrives in Plovdiv carrying much recent momentum. Danial Spasov has lost all five of his latest matches, while Franco Ribero has four losses from five, the lone win coming against Dragos Nicolae Cazacu. That makes the Challenger Plovdiv odds a notable contrast: Ribero is the clear favourite in the early prices even though his recent form line is hardly dominant.
There is no head-to-head record between them, so the numbers offer no direct clue about how this pairing might play out. That leaves recent results and the wider surface context as the main reference points. This is an outdoor clay event during the clay-court swing, a setting where rallies tend to lengthen and patience matters more. For a player priced as a heavy favourite, the limited recent wins are at least a small counterweight to the wide price gap.
The pricing is straightforward, but so is the caution. Spasov is the higher-priced player with no recent wins to point to; Ribero has the lower price, yet his own form is far from emphatic. With no H2H and both players coming off mixed results, the first prices may be the clearest statement of where this match is expected to go.
